The purpose of this thesis is twofold. First, it is designed to provide a general overview of
current DMRD 910 requirements, the current status of DFAS efforts in implementing policy to
satisfy those requirements, and what impact the requirements have had on a Marine Field
Disbursing Office. The second purpose is to produce a single source document for use by future
Marine Corps graduates in Financial Management that encompasses a historical background of
DMRD 910 and its objectives, an overview of DFAS's Implementation Plan and concept of
operations, an overview of the Marine Corps Implementation and Transition Plans, and a detailed
review of the organizational structure and concept of operations of a Marine Field Disbursing
Office before and after implementation of DMRD 910. The research for this thesis uncovered
several key points concerning DMRD 910 and its impact on a Marine Field Disbursing Office.
